Temporal gating of SIRT1 functions by O-GlcNAcylation prevents hyperglycemia and enables physiological transitions in liver
2019-04-02
Abstract excerpt
<h4>Summary</h4> Inefficient fasted-to-refed transitions are known to cause metabolic diseases. Thus, identifying mechanisms that may constitute molecular switches during such physiological transitions become crucial. Specifically, whether nutrients program a relay of interactions in master regulators, such as SIRT1, and affect their stability is underexplored.
